New Lothrop hit Birch Run with a four-run second inning on Monday, which goes a long way in explaining the final result. The Panthers fell just short of the Hornets by a score of 7-6. The Panthers were not able to repeat the success they had when they faced the Hornets earlier this season, when they won 10-8.
Birch Run's loss dropped their record down to 2-5. As for New Lothrop, they are on a roll lately: they've won three of their last four contests. That's provided a massive bump to their 6-5 record this season.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Birch Run will face off against Montrose at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day. The Panthers are facing the Rams at the right time seeing as the Rams are stuck on a four-game losing streak. As for New Lothrop, they will head out to face off against Lakeville at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day. The Falcons' pitching crew has only allowed 3.5 runs per game this season, so the Hornets' hitters will have their work cut out for them.
